What device is commonly used in Electric/Electronics for Processing Elements (Control Elements)?

Explanation:
Processing elements need a device that can run a control program, make decisions, and drive outputs in real time. A Programmable Logic Controller provides exactly that: it reads inputs from sensors, executes a user-defined control program (with logic, timers, counters, arithmetic), and outputs signals to actuators. It’s designed for reliability and real-time operation in industrial environments, and it’s easily programmed and reconfigured for different control tasks, which is why it’s the standard choice for processing elements inElectric/Electronics control systems. Switches are manual input devices, not processors. Sensors supply data as inputs, not processing logic. Relays can implement simple, hard-wired logic but don’t execute programs or perform flexible processing like a PLC.
